I have Muscular Dystrophy and during college some friends and I went to Johnny Carino's and we parked in a handicapped spot. We were getting out of the car and some woman came from inside the restaurant and told me I couldn't park there because it was for handicapped people and I don't look handicapped when just standing around.

I am now 40 and continue to park in handicapped spots, and shock, I can carry things even though I am physically disabled. Mind your own business.
